Essentia Health St. Mary’s Children's Hospital (SMCH) and Pediatrics Clinics in Duluth, MN provide highly specialized, regional pediatric care close to home.  We are dedicated to providing patient and family centered care in a multidisciplinary manner.  That focus has allowed us to grow a diverse pediatric subspecialty practice, in addition to comprehensive general pediatric care. We enjoy a close working relationship with our Family Advisory Council, Child Life Specialists, pediatric Pharmacists, pediatric Dieticians, pediatric Behavioral Specialists (including child psychiatry), and pediatric Therapists (PT, OT, and SLP).  Our many achievements include the region's only: Level III NICU, Pediatric Hospitalist service, PICU, Pediatric Cancer Center, Pediatric Therapy Center, inpatient Pediatric Rehabilitation unit, and the pediatric behavioral health and substance abuse treatment center, Amberwing.  St. Mary's Children's Hospital is designated by the National Association of Children's Hospitals and Related Institutions (NAHCRI) as a Children's Hospital within a hospital and is 1 of only 8 Children's Hospitals in MN. 

PRACTICE SPECIFICS:

  • Level III NICU with 18 private rooms. Average 330 admissions/year; Average daily census – 14 infants
  • Join 4 MDs, 4 NNPs, 1 PA, and an outstanding nursing staff.
  • 24/7 in house coverage
  • Well established and collaborative relationship with Level IV NICUs in the Twin Cities area.
  • Strong OB physician and perinatologist support. 24/7 OB Hospitalist model.
  • Pediatric specialists and sub-specialists on staff ranging from oncology to neurology
  • Supporting member of NACHRI, committed to excellence in providing health care to children through clinical care, research, training and advocacy
  • Strong quality programming including participation in the Vermont Oxford Network (VON) database and quality initiatives.
  • Active Neonatal Transport Team serving MN, WI and MI
